What will the apprentice be doing?
Key duties
- To prepare and deliver assigned programmes of teaching and learning activities to an individual pupil modifying and adapting activities as necessary by working in partnership with the class teacher and SENDco.
- Assess, record and report on development, progress and attainment.
- Liaise with staff and other relevant professionals and provide information about pupils as appropriate.
- Assess the needs of a pupil and use detailed knowledge and specialist skills to support pupils' learning.
- Support pupils in social and emotional well-being, putting the child first to ensure they are given all the necessary tools to be the best me they can be.
- Help keep the children safe and have good understanding of safeguarding.
- Be part of the school team and community by developing and promoting positive working relationships with staff, pupils, parents, governors and the wider school community.
- Support the role of parents / carers in pupil learning and contribute to meetings with parents / carers to provide constructive feedback on pupil progress/achievement etc.
What training will the apprentice take and what qualification will the apprentice get at the end?
Level 3 Teaching Assistant Apprenticeship Apprenticeship Standard:
This training programme focuses on developing classroom delivery and work within schools.
The Diploma aims to grow your existing skillset in the following key areas:
- Increased mastery of the critical stages of child and adolescent development
- Enhance understanding of the types of influences that can affect this development
- Become fully adept in supporting teachers with the planning of activities, as well as creating own activity plans
- Evaluation of personal performance in relation to supporting literacy, numeracy, and ICT
- Amplify knowledge of safeguarding, and emergency procedures
- Understand legislation with regard to confidentiality, data protection, and information sharing

About the employer
Local Authority maintained primary school in north Nottinghamshire. Rural, village school with a high percentage of pupils outside of catchment (Retford and surrounding villages). We have an Early Years class's and take children from 3-11. We currently have 140 pupils on roll. We have lower than the national average of children with pupil premium, SEND, and EAL.
